引言
随着互联网技术的飞速发展,网站建设已经成为企业和个人展示自身形象、拓展业务的重要途径。前端框架作为网站建设的重要工具,能够极大地提高网页设计的效率和质量。本文将详细介绍如何掌握网站建设前端框架,开启高效网页设计之旅。
一、前端框架概述
1.1 前端框架的定义
前端框架是指一套提供了一套标准化的编码规范、组件库和工具集的前端开发工具。它可以帮助开发者快速构建高质量的网页,提高开发效率。
1.2 前端框架的分类
目前,前端框架主要分为以下几类:
- UI框架:如Bootstrap、Foundation等,主要提供了一套丰富的UI组件和样式。
- MV*框架:如React、Vue.js、Angular等,主要关注于数据绑定、组件化和模块化。
- 响应式框架:如Flexbox、Grid等,主要解决不同设备下的布局问题。
二、掌握前端框架的步骤
2.1 学习基础知识
在掌握前端框架之前,需要具备以下基础知识:
- HTML/CSS:了解网页的基本结构和样式。
- JavaScript:掌握JavaScript的基本语法和常用API。
- 版本控制:熟悉Git等版本控制工具。
2.2 选择合适的前端框架
根据项目需求和自身兴趣,选择合适的前端框架。以下是一些热门的前端框架:
- React:Facebook推出的前端框架,具有组件化、虚拟DOM等特点。
- Vue.js:易学易用,具有响应式数据绑定和组件化等特点。
- Angular:Google推出的前端框架,具有模块化、双向数据绑定等特点。
2.3 学习框架文档
阅读所选框架的官方文档,了解框架的特性和使用方法。以下是一些学习框架文档的步骤:
- 阅读官方文档:了解框架的基本概念、组件、API等。
- 实践项目:通过实际项目应用框架,加深对框架的理解。
- 参考社区资源:查阅社区论坛、博客等资源,解决遇到的问题。
2.4 深入理解框架原理
了解框架的原理,有助于更好地运用框架。以下是一些深入理解框架原理的方法:
- 源码分析:阅读框架的源码,了解其实现原理。
- 性能优化:学习如何优化框架的性能。
- 插件开发:学习如何开发插件,扩展框架的功能。
三、前端框架在实际项目中的应用
3.1 项目需求分析
在项目开发前,进行需求分析,明确项目目标、功能、性能等方面的要求。
3.2 框架选型与搭建
根据项目需求,选择合适的前端框架,搭建项目的基本结构。
3.3 组件化开发
利用框架的组件化特性,将项目拆分为多个模块,提高开发效率。
3.4 数据绑定与状态管理
利用框架的数据绑定和状态管理功能,实现数据的实时更新和组件的交互。
3.5 响应式布局
利用框架提供的响应式布局组件,实现不同设备下的适配。
3.6 性能优化
针对项目性能进行优化,提高用户体验。
四、总结
掌握网站建设前端框架,是开启高效网页设计之旅的关键。通过学习基础知识、选择合适的前端框架、深入理解框架原理和实际应用,可以快速提高网页设计能力。希望本文能对您有所帮助。
